Skip to main content

pullhero CLI

Project description

(pullhero)

This the pullhero python client.

How to push a code review

pullhero --vcs-provider github \
         --vcs-token ghp_B...sw \
         --vcs-repository pullhero/python-client \
         --vcs-change-id 1 \
         --vcs-change-type issue_with_pr \
         --vcs-base-branch unknown \
         --vcs-head-branch unknown \
         --agent review \
         --agent-action comment \
         --llm-api-key sk-ec....e4 \
         --llm-api-host api.deepseek.com \
         --llm-api-model deepseek-chat

How to push a README.md documentation improvement

pullhero --vcs-provider github \
         --vcs-token ghp_B...sw \
         --vcs-repository pullhero/python-client \
         --vcs-change-id 11111 \
         --vcs-change-type whatever \
         --vcs-base-branch main \
         --vcs-head-branch unknown \
         --agent document \
         --agent-action comment \
         --llm-api-key 3....et \
         --llm-api-host api.mistral.ai \
         --llm-api-model mistral-large-latest

How to push the consult agent

pullhero --vcs-provider github \
         --vcs-token ghp_B...sw \
         --vcs-repository pullhero/python-client \
         --vcs-change-id 1111 \
         --vcs-change-type whatever \
         --vcs-base-branch whatever \
         --vcs-head-branch whatever \
         --agent consult \
         --agent-action comment \
         --llm-api-key 3....et \
         --llm-api-host api.mistral.ai \
         --llm-api-model mistral-large-latest

How to run the code improvement agent

pullhero --vcs-provider github \
         --vcs-token ghp_B...sw \
         --vcs-repository pullhero/python-client \
         --vcs-change-id 4 \
         --vcs-change-type whatever \
         --vcs-base-branch "main" \
         --vcs-head-branch "feature_test" \
         --agent code \
         --agent-action comment \
         --llm-api-key 3....et \
         --llm-api-host api.mistral.ai \
         --llm-api-model mistral-large-latest

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pullhero-0.0.8.tar.gz (22.4 kB view details)

Uploaded Source

File details

Details for the file pullhero-0.0.8.tar.gz.

File metadata

  • Download URL: pullhero-0.0.8.tar.gz
  • Upload date:
  • Size: 22.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.11.12

File hashes

Hashes for pullhero-0.0.8.tar.gz
Algorithm Hash digest
SHA256 d47fc5b40bdb2fbb1fcd4ff8a861048640da0be5b756d5e670fd0c96849ba67b
MD5 daf1a530a1714c3a956020b601a0f830
BLAKE2b-256 eb5d14d9a6365aae81e2c6829531a49a4a099e43a81315ea76341734b4c2c2a0

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page